Wrap ductap around the end of the braided hose, then take a hacksaw and cut off about 1/4" to 1/2" of the tube. When your hacking it off, cut in the middle of the duct tape, this will prevent the braids from fraying and enlarging. Once you have cut the hose leave the duct tape on it then slide the aluminum fitting over before you take the tape off. You can then screw it onto the other fitting.
